You can apply for unemployment compensation for your State unemployment office. You must qualify based on enough earnings and enough quarters worked. This will determine your weekly benefit if eligible. these monies are paid from funds contributed by the employee and employer deducted as UC insurance.
The Soc Security Administration has nothing to do with this at all.

If I was awaiting approval of I-485 and my employer laid me off (assuming I am working with EAD), could I apply for unemployment (collect unemploymwnt) with the Social Security Administration?

status is called pending AOS.
As far as I know, if you don't use EAD, you are still in H1B status, that is, if something happens and AOS is denied, you will still be in H1B status as far as your legal status is concerned.
